Thielman, Dorothy Elizabeth was born on May 4, 1937 in Twodot, Montana, United States. Daughter of Thomas William and Dorothy Robertson (Smart) Hayman.
Diploma in nursing, Deaconess Medical Center, Spokane, Washington, 1958. Bachelor of Science in Vocational Education, University Idaho, 1979. Certified in enterostomal therapy, Abbott Northwestern Hospital, Minneapolis, 1982.
Staff nurse, Deaconess medical Center, Spokane, 1958-1959; staff nurse, Providence Hospital, Wallace, Idaho., 1959; staff nurse, Coeur d'Alene (Idaho) General Hospital, 1960; staff nurse, West Shoshone General Hospital, Kellogg, Idaho., 1961, 65-80; nurse, welfare investigator, County of Shoshone, Wallace, 1961-1964; school nurse, health occupations instructor, Wallace School District 393, 1972-1979; charge nurse, enterostomal therapist, director quality assurance, Kootenai Medical Center, Coeur d'Alene, since 1980.
Chairman board trustees School District 393, Wallace, 1989. Board directors American Heart Association, Kellogg, 1978-1980. Moderator United Church of Christ Congressional, Wallace.
Member Idaho Nurses Association (nursing practice advisory group, secretary-treasurer), Idaho Health Occupation Vocational Association (president 1978), International Association Enterostomal Therapy (president northwest region 1988-1992), Business and Professional Women American (district director 1978), Rotary (president-elect).
Married John Fred Thielman, September 14, 1963. Children: John William, Dorothy Christina, Robynn Elizabeth, Thomas Fred.
